研究目的
To evaluate the efficacy of different photobiomodulation protocols (red, infrared, and red associated with infrared laser) on pain of patients with TMD and to assess the immediate and longitudinal impact of proposed treatments on pain and mandibular mobility.
研究成果
This investigation will contribute to enlighten a evidence-based practice of PBMT for TMD, by reporting the effects of specific wavelengths on pain and mandibular function of individuals with myalgia and arthralgia.
研究不足
The care provider cannot be blinded to allocation due to the nature of the intervention.
1:Experimental Design and Method Selection:
Randomized, controlled, parallel, double-blind clinical trial.
2:Sample Selection and Data Sources:
Volunteers seeking treatment at the primary care clinic of the Interdisciplinary Orofacial Pain League.
3:List of Experimental Equipment and Materials:
Therapy XT laser equipment (DMC, S?o Carlos, Brazil), Pain Test FPX 25 Algometer (Wagner Instruments, Greenwich, USA).
4:Experimental Procedures and Operational Workflow:
Participants will undergo PBMT according to the group to which they were allocated, with evaluations at initial (T1), after the 1st treatment session (T2), at the end of treatment (T3), and 30 days after the last PBMT session (T4).
